Key Factors to Consider When Choosing a Construction Company

1. Experience & Track Record

✅ Pros:

  • Experienced firms handle unexpected challenges better.
  • They have established supplier networks for better material pricing.
  • Lower risk of abandoned projects.

❌ Cons:

  • Some long-standing companies charge premium rates.
  • A few rely on reputation without modern techniques.

🔹 Solution:

  • Look for 5+ years of relevant experience (e.g., residential, commercial).
  • Check completed projects (visit sites if possible).

2. Licensing & Legal Compliance

✅ Pros:

  • Registered companies follow building codes, avoiding fines.
  • Easier permit approvals from local authorities.

❌ Cons:

🔹 Solution:

  • Verify CAC registration and COREN certification (for engineers).
  • Ask for SON compliance (Standards Organisation of Nigeria).

3. Transparent Pricing & Contracts

✅ Pros:

  • Detailed contracts prevent disputes and hidden charges.
  • Fixed-price agreements protect your budget.

❌ Cons:

  • Some firms give low quotes but inflate costs later.

🔹 Solution:

  • Get 3+ detailed quotes for comparison.
  • Use milestone-based payments (e.g., 30% upfront, 40% at completion).

4. Quality of Materials & Workmanship

✅ Pros:

  • High-quality materials increase building lifespan.
  • Skilled labor reduces maintenance costs.

❌ Cons:

  • Some contractors use substandard materials to maximize profit.

🔹 Solution:

  • Specify materials in the contract (e.g., “German nails, Dangote cement”).
  • Hire an independent surveyor to inspect work at critical stages.

5. Safety Standards & Insurance

✅ Pros:

  • Proper safety protocols prevent accidents.
  • Insurance covers injuries or damages.

❌ Cons:

  • Many Nigerian sites ignore safety measures.

🔹 Solution:

  • Demand proof of workers’ compensation insurance.
  • Visit sites to check safety gear usage (helmets, harnesses).

6. Client Testimonials & Case Studies

  • Before hiring, ask for:
    • Video testimonials from past clients
    • Photos of completed projects in your area (e.g., Lagos)
    • References you can call directly

7. Timeline Management

Nigerian construction delays often stem from:

  • Poor weather planning (rainy season disruptions)
  • Material shortages (always confirm supplier backups)
  • Payment disputes (use milestone-based contracts)

8. Post-Construction Support

The best construction company in Nigeria offers:

  • 1-year defect liability period
  • Warranty on electrical/plumbing work
  • Free maintenance advice

Red Flags to Avoid

🚩 No physical office or valid contact details
🚩 Unwillingness to provide references
🚩 Pressure to pay full amount upfront
🚩 Vague contracts without timelines
